Part Overview
The MMWA05P1K is a 0.1 µF film capacitor manufactured by Cornell Dubilier Electronics (CDE) with a 50V DC voltage rating and ±10% tolerance. This component is classified as obsolete, which necessitates identification of equivalent substitute parts for ongoing design support and procurement continuity. The part features polyester metallized dielectric construction in an axial through-hole package suitable for general-purpose applications.

Engineering Selection Recommendations
The MMWA05P1K-F serves as the direct substitute for the obsolete MMWA05P1K. Both parts are manufactured by Cornell Dubilier Electronics within the same MMWA series and maintain identical electrical and mechanical specifications across all critical parameters.
The primary distinction between the main part and its substitute is product status and regulatory compliance. The MMWA05P1K is classified as obsolete, whereas the MMWA05P1K-F maintains active production status. Additionally, the MMWA05P1K-F achieves ROHS3 compliance, whereas the original part is RoHS non-compliant. Both parts maintain REACH Unaffected status and share identical ECCN and HTSUS classifications.
For new designs or component replenishment, the MMWA05P1K-F is the appropriate selection due to its active availability and enhanced regulatory compliance posture. Existing circuit designs utilizing the MMWA05P1K may be directly updated to incorporate the MMWA05P1K-F without modification to PCB layout, schematic design, or functional performance parameters.
